Improving Below-ground Mine Wellbeing: Best Methods

Wiki Article

To ensure a improved working location in below-ground excavations, several optimal procedures are vital. These include comprehensive hazard assessments, routine gas detection and ventilation systems , and the deployment of robust communication systems . Furthermore, ongoing education for staff on crisis response plans, ground stability , and the proper use of safety apparatus is paramount . Finally, a mindset of proactive security and continuous advancement should be promoted at all levels within the site.

Underground Mine Safety: A Forward-looking Approach

Maintaining a safe location in subterranean mines demands a preventative solution. Traditional backward-looking safety measures, addressing incidents after they occur, are inadequate to defend personnel. A modern approach emphasizes hazard pinpointing and risk lessening through routine inspections, modern technology implementation , and comprehensive worker education . This shift towards a preventative mindset cultivates a atmosphere of safety, resulting in a significant decrease in accidents and enhanced overall mine operation .
